What Almirall (BME:ALM)'s €250 Million Bond Issue Means For Shareholders

Almirall, S.A. recently completed a €250 million fixed-income offering, issuing 3.75% senior unsecured notes due 2031 at 100% of principal. This successful bond placement increases Almirall’s financial flexibility, which could matter for funding its dermatology pipeline and managing upcoming investment needs. How Exane’s Shift From Outperform To Neutral At Bankinter (BME:BKT) Has Changed Its Investment Story

Earlier this week, Exane BNP Paribas cut its rating on Bankinter from “outperform” to “neutral,” saying European banks no longer offer a uniform upside and that it now prefers other names in the sector. The downgrade marks a shift from more than four years of consistent optimism toward European banks and signals that investors may need to be more selective when comparing Bankinter with peers such as HSBC and UniCredit. Is Santander’s Focus on Large Mortgages Reframing Its UK Strategy for Banco Santander (BME:SAN)?

In early December 2025, Santander joined more than 20 UK lenders in trimming mortgage rates ahead of an anticipated Bank Rate cut, including a 3.51% deal for home movers on loans between £500,000 and £2,000,000. The decision to offer sharper pricing only on larger mortgages highlights Santander’s focus on higher-value, lower-unit-cost lending as competition intensifies in the UK housing market.
